Reimagining the Future of Arts Education
Strategic Planning & Social Impact Strategy
Founded by Walt Disney in 1961, CalArts is one of the most pioneering institutions of higher education in the arts—a place where animators, actors, musicians, dancers, directors, writers, painters, and designers could all coexist under one roof. This multidisciplinary community of artists forms the DNA of CalArts, and would also come to form the heart of CalArts’ future growth and impact.
Along with her team at LaPlaca Cohen, Diane led a multi-year participatory strategy process that mobilized CalArts’ students, faculty, staff, board, parents, alums, local community, and global field leaders to imagine a new future for higher education in the arts. Everything was on the table to be redesigned, from the affordability of arts education and underlying business model of the university to the pipeline programs and community partnerships the school could provide.
The process culminated with the development of new mission, vision and values statements, an Opportunity Assessment that outlined future growth and impact pathways, as well as a Strategic Framework which defined CalArts’ guiding pillars of impact as well as its goals and objectives for the next 5-10 years.
